Bakery 88
88号西点店
52 Foreigner Street Center (facing Bo'ai Lu), Dali
大理洋人街中心52号(临博爱路)
Phone: (0872) 2679129
Website: www.bakery88.com
German-style bakery featuring homemade breads and jams and local organic products
